Subject: DR drill — Brightkettle log sampling

Hi,

During tomorrow's disaster-recovery drill we'll drop Brightkettle's log sampling rate from 100% to 5%, since the service floods the aggregator within minutes of failover. Sampling reverts automatically when the drill ends. No action needed from release side beyond holding deploys during the window. To restore the sampling config vault afterward, use the recovery passphrase below.

unlock words, yawig-kagef: gordor-holvan-ulaael-pramir-ulaiel-tamdor

Subject: DR drill notes — greenhouse controller sensor drift

For Thursday's sync: during the Larkfield DR drill we restored the Verdura controller from cold backup and found humidity sensors drifting 4–6% post-restore. Calibration tables weren't included in the snapshot; fix is queued. Workaround is manual recalibration from the bench console after any restore. The console unlocks with the recovery passphrase below.

unlock words, kaweg-bafog: zorwyn-julix

Ticket #4521: Spreadsheet export plugin dropping connections

Hey plugin folks — we're seeing the GridHopper export module chew through memory when exporting sheets over 50k rows, and once it spikes, the pooled connections to the backing store start timing out. Quick fix for now: chunk your exports to 10k rows per batch. For testing against our staging instance, use the connection string below.

primary connection of yagep-kahip = redis://giliel_svc:zYiKsLL2PLpfPL@db-348f.xolmarsys.corp:5432/fenwyn

## ProfileVault Environments

ProfileVault shards the user-profile store across four partitions in staging and sixteen in production. Shard assignment is hash-based on account ID, so rebalancing only happens during planned resharding windows. If you're on call and see hot-shard alerts, check the partition map before touching anything — most pages resolve to a single overloaded shard. The active shard configuration for production is as follows.

settings of hahag-taweg:
[jorius]
team = gilox
access_code = ac_b64218
host = jorius.zarqelstack.example
port = 8080
owner = quenath.briax
peer = eliix.halixcloud.corp